Address 0.335796 PPC

PB19tdWdQ7Ko65JoD2WVhz1XiKrMELgeCB

Confirmed

Total Received0.335796 PPC
Total Sent0 PPC
Final Balance0.335796 PPC
No. Transactions1

Transactions

PNQuZMED3K9Q3xxEmSMPZooRVEPVKh8wjt0.19615 PPC
PB19tdWdQ7Ko65JoD2WVhz1XiKrMELgeCB0.335796 PPC ×
Fee: 0.01 PPC
665948 Confirmations0.531946 PPC